Transaction 66619218052bfdce671797d36625bef0936fb590576f0a57c79f16537e4fa977

2 Input
2 Outputs
  • 66619218052bfdce671797d36625bef0936fb590576f0a57c79f16537e4fa977:0
  • value  1452800
    address  2MzihzyZn5an1FwjWsemSKYCJkdkuAfTo78
  • 66619218052bfdce671797d36625bef0936fb590576f0a57c79f16537e4fa977:1
  • value  1000000
    address  mgUXPxg4YGSR1wiJhdScrpAXm1f6TvCAFX